Abstract

A method for distributing timely information over a computer network where a Timely Information Server collects and organizes information from Timely Information Providers and then broadcasts the organized information to endusers in the form of an alerts over a plurality of alert channels. The alert is comprised of keywords and arguments, wherein the keywords describe the subject matter of the alert and the arguments provide content of the alert. The Timely Information Server maintains a dictionary of all possible keywords and the endusers copy a portion of the dictionary to their local computers to create individual keyword profiles which are comprised of keywords and Boolean operators. When an alert satisfies a Boolean equation in a users keyword profile the headline of the alert (stored as an argument) is displayed and the user is given the option to link his/her web browser to an associated URL (also stored as an argument).
